What exactly is the human threat surface?
And what’s HackNotice?

Knowing your attack surface is the foundation of a proactive security program, since you can’t protect what you can’t find. However, security teams are often missing a large part of their attack surface – the human aspect. Third and fourth party vendors, critical supply chain data incidents, shadow IT, and employee-specific websites and accounts all add up to a significant attack surface that is often overlooked, hard to keep track of, and unknown even to the most advanced organizations. It’s this attack surface that hackers target and exploit the most, with devastating consequences.

With everything from corporate domain monitoring, third-party risk management, account takeover protection, defense against advanced persistent threats, and even protecting employees in their personal lives, with HackNotice you can eliminate the dangerous blind spot that is your human threat surface.
